Ingredients:

Frozen, fully cooked meatballs, enough to fill the crock pot two-thirds full (see picture below) I get mine at Sam’s Club

28 oz can crushed tomatoes

14 oz can diced tomatoes

1-2 bottles of your favorite marinara sauce (may need 2, see “Note to Self” at bottom of post)

2 tsp of Italian Seasoning (not shown in photo)

Place half the bag of frozen meatballs into crock pot to fill it about two-thirds full.

In separate bowl, mix the rest of the ingredients together.

Pour sauce over meatballs in crock pot and gently stir until the majority of meatballs are coated with sauce.

Cover and cook on high for 4 hours or on low for 6-8 hours in crock pot.

Serve over spaghetti or pasta of your choice. Enjoy.  YUM!

*Note to self:  Since I let it cook for a longer amount of time, like the 6-8 hours, next time I will add one more bottle of marinara sauce to make up for the sauce simmering down.
